I work at North Bay Aquatics and refuse to sell fish to stupid people often and i feel we have a loyal customer base because of our efforts to educate people.I think its better to make money with repeat bussiness and people getting more involved in fish keeping then upgrading and such than to make a few bucks on the one time sale that i know will end in ruin
 
I find the vast majority of customers quite understanding after you explain things to them. The key is proper explanation, just telling them they can't have X number of fish doesn't work. You have to explain the nitrogen cycle, etc.
